Job Description

MicroHealth is seeking a hand-on Database Developer with expertise in SQL, DB2 and Linux. The Database Developer will be responsible for the implementation, configuration, maintenance, and performance of critical SQL Server RDBMS while supporting the enterprise reporting and analytics environment. The ideal candidate will work with data architects to implement standard enterprise data models that align with healthcare industry’s best practices and ensure solutions are cloud-enabled.Responsibilities And DutiesManage and administer SQL Server databases in both Windows and Linux environmentsConfigure and maintain database servers and processes across multiple platformsImplement data models (conceptual, logical, and physical) developed by data architectsMonitor system health and performance using enterprise monitoring toolsEnsure high levels of performance, availability, sustainability, and securityAnalyze, solve, and correct issues in real timeProvide technical solutions and recommendations for database optimizationRefine and automate regular processes, track issues, and document changesAssist developers with query tuning and schema refinementSupport data integration efforts to leverage new healthcare datasets through product capabilitiesClean and validate data for uniformity and accuracyImplement database solutions that support predictive modeling and analyticsCoordinate with different functional teams to implement models and monitor outcomesProvide support for critical production systemsPerform scheduled maintenance and support release deployment activities after hoursAdminister Linux systems hosting SQL Server instancesImplement security best practices across database environmentsExperience with InfoSphere, including Quality Stage. Additionally, InfoSystem's IRIS, and Linux policy preferred. Qualifications and SkillsBachelor’s degree in computer science, Information Technology, or related field (Master's preferred)Strong SQL Server Administration experience requiredStrong SQL Server Administration experience requiredExperience with High Availability (HA) and Disaster Recovery (DR) options for SQL ServerExperience with Windows server, including Active DirectoryStrong Linux administration skills including shell scripting, permissions, and system managementExperience with SQL Server on Linux deploymentsKnowledge of database security best practicesHealth data experience is a mustExperience working with healthcare data models and structuresKnowledge of data mining techniques and implementing data architectureExcellent problem-solving and communication skillsSQL Server certifications preferredSalary- $110k-$120kMicroHealth is unable to provide visa sponsorship at this time.
